Prep time:

10 minutes 

Cook time:

0 minutes 

Total time:

1 hour 10 minutes

Serves:

4

Ingredients: 

  • 2 ripe bananas, sliced 
  • 1/4 cup creamy peanut butter, or almond butter 
  • 1/2 cup dark chocolate, melted 
  • Chopped nuts, optional, for garnish

Method: 

Method: 

1.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and set aside. 

2. Spread a small amount of peanut butter onto 1 banana slice. Top with an additional banana slice making a small sandwich. Repeat with remaining ingredients. 3. Place onto prepared baking sheet and freeze until firm, at least 1 hour, or overnight. 4. Place chocolate in a microwave-safe bowl and microwave in 10-second increments, stirring between each increment until melted and completely smooth, about 40-60 seconds. 

5. Dip each frozen banana bite halfway into melted chocolate and return to baking sheet. 6. Sprinkle with chopped nuts before chocolate sets. Return bites to freezer for about 10 minutes, or until chocolate hardens. 

Tip: Store in an airtight container in the freezer for up to 1 month.
